Coursera offers a vast array of accreditation programs. It is regularly asked whether Coursera is totally free, and if it provides free certificates.
The website says it uses a free, seven-day trial. However, there are reports online of students having problem terminating a trial, although some may have simply forgotten to cancel on time.
Search our list below of the types of degrees and certificates used by Coursera.
These are the individual courses that Coursera uses. Some are consisted of in the seven-day totally free trial, however once those 7 days are over, the course will change to a monthly subscription strategy of an average of $49 per month until the course finishes.
Expertises. This is the term utilized to explain a group of 4 to nine courses. They belong to the membership payment of $49-$ 79 a month and also included a seven-day complimentary trial. They generally include group tasks.

Remember that the faster you finish your courses, the less money it will cost you. One danger with these expertise courses is that if the site has any bugs that stop you from transferring to the next lesson, you might end up paying more than you had actually expected, due to their absence of customer support.
Expert Certificates. The advantage to be stated about Coursera’s expert certificates is that some of them are transferable as university credits. Nevertheless, they are likewise provided in groups of courses, like the specializations, so they usually cost a lot more than a validated certificate course.
Master’s Degrees. The master’s degrees provided on the website are somewhat cheaper than a college degree, usually costing around $22,000. These are not subscription-based however are more of a normal college payment approach instead.
Some of these certificates can also count towards a master’s degree. The certificate course costs in between $2,000 and $5,000, not consisting of books and possible surprise charges.
Bachelor of Applied Arts and Sciences. These are Coursera’s bachelor’s degree options. They cost in between $15,000 and $43,000 and can be paid completely or in increments.

Coursera is one of dozens of platforms that use Enormous Open Online Courses (MOOCs) as well as degrees, expert courses, Coursera specializations, and MasterTrack courses. Coursera was founded in 2012 by Stanford computer science teachers Daphne Koller and Andrew Ng.
This Coursera course report may look familiar, but Coursera is not the only company of MOOCs. If you research online, you’ll find that there are lots of other options, such as Udemy, FutureLearn, and others.
It’s the sheer breadth of Coursera’s offerings that sets it apart from the competitors. The University of Michigan, Princeton University, Stanford University and the University of Pennsylvania are among the first schools to provide material on the platform. This allows users to access an Ivy League-level education without ever leaving house or being accepted to these completing organizations.
The Coursera courses last about 4 to twelve weeks and include one to two hours of video lectures weekly.
As with any other course, Coursera courses differ a bit depending on the option you select. Some consist of tests, graded assignments, and weekly exercises, while others may consist of final examinations, last tasks, or perhaps honors projects!
